APM Terminals Expands Multimodal Reach with Panama Canal Railway Buy

APM Terminals Expands Multimodal Reach with Panama Canal Railway Buy

Maersk's APM Terminals acquired Panama Canal Railway Company (PCRC) to strengthen its intermodal capabilities. PCRC, a vital land bridge connecting the Atlantic and Pacific Oceans, significantly enhances APM Terminals' global supply chain strategy. This acquisition aims to improve cargo transfer efficiency, reduce transportation costs, and further solidify Maersk's position as a leading integrated logistics provider. The PCRC will play a key role in streamlining operations and optimizing connectivity across the Panama Canal region.

Jdcom Exits Southeast Asia Amid Localization Struggles

Jdcom Exits Southeast Asia Amid Localization Struggles

JD.com's closure of its e-commerce platforms in Indonesia and Thailand marks a setback in its Southeast Asia strategy. Facing intense competition and localization challenges, JD.com is shifting its focus to strengthening logistics infrastructure, providing supply chain services for the global market. Overseas expansion for e-commerce giants requires overcoming policy and cultural challenges, with localized operations being crucial. Cross-border sellers should understand the market, optimize sales channels, and provide localized services to succeed.
